The China stock market declined again on Thursday, with the Shanghai Composite Index dropping 56.43 points (1.39%) to close at 4,006.55. The Shenzhen Composite Index fell 60.93 points (2.27%) to 2,619.95. Concerns over the Middle East conflict and weak global forecasts contributed to the downturn, despite some support from financial shares. Major U.S. indices also experienced losses, reflecting a broader trend in the markets. Oil prices eased, which may limit further declines in Asian markets.
